wait, what? so you cant change the inventory of your party members? does their equipment atleast upgrade as they level up? they do level up, right?
 
Joined
Apr 2, 2009
Messages
3,505 (0.64/day)
wait, what? so you cant change the inventory of your party members? does their equipment atleast upgrade as they level up? they do level up, right?

They level up by giving them "gifts". They are certain special items found throughout the game. You can naturally find few along normal play and some others require some searching.

As they upgrade, they appearance change a little along the way.

wait, what? so you cant change the inventory of your party members? does their equipment atleast upgrade as they level up? they do level up, right?

well thats gay.

basically, doing their side quests upgrades their armor. sometimes via random items you can buy as gifts.


most of them allow you to choose what weapon they have, varric for example you cant.


mostly its just belt, two rings, one amulet you can customise.
